I saw something like this, one time. The simplest
workaround was to set write permission to particular
printer in /var/spool/lpd for everybody.
But, as I said, this was the simplest solution, not the
best.
Samba Gurus, do you know something better ?

I have tried everything and read all your documentation but I cannot get
an
NT printer to print from Unix (Solaris 2.6). I can connect to the printer
using smbclient and get the smb> prompt. However I then cannot print a
file
using the print command. If I use cat file-name | smbclient
\\\\server\\client -c "print -" I get the error message "session setup
failed : ERRDOS - ERRnoaccess (Access denied)". This is obviously why it
won't print but I have no idea why.
I am using Samba Version 2.0.4b as supplied with Using Samba.
